推荐一款革命性的自托管数据库管理工具——undb
在寻求高效、安全且易于使用的数据存储解决方案时,我们常常会遇到各种挑战。今天,我要向您推荐一个名为undb
的开源项目,它是一个私密优先、统一的无代码数据库管理系统,集轻量化、高度自定义和实时同步于一身。
项目介绍
undb
以其简洁的界面和强大的功能著称,让您能够快速创建和管理数据库,无需编写任何代码。只需单个文件存储,即可实现自我托管,让数据掌握在自己手中。此外,undb
还提供多种视图类型,如网格、看板、甘特图、树状图和日历等,满足不同场景的需求。
项目技术分析
- 前端采用高性能的SvelteKit框架,确保了应用程序的流畅运行。
- 后端基于Nestjs进行逻辑组织,遵循领域驱动设计,使代码更易于维护。
- 开发过程中,利用Vite + SWC 快速编译TypeScript代码,并结合Tailwind进行样式布局。
- 提供开放API、Webhook、实时订阅以及SDK(即将推出),充分展现其开发者友好性。
项目及技术应用场景
- 对于小型企业和个人开发者,
undb
可以作为一个轻量级的数据存储平台,简化项目管理。 - 对于团队协作,它的多视图展示和权限控制功能,可支持项目进度跟踪、任务分配等多种工作流程。
- 在教育领域,可用于课程管理和学生信息记录,同时,通过开放API,能与其他系统集成,增强数据互通性。
项目特点
- 隐私保护:私人数据始终是第一要务,您的数据仅对您和您指定的人可见。
- 快速部署:只需要几秒钟,就可以通过Docker或其他方式进行自托管。
- 高度自定义:从字段类型到视图样式,您可以自由定制数据库的每个细节。
- 强大功能:内置多类型字段、权限控制、回收站功能,还有模板支持,满足多样化需求。
立即尝试在线演示,或者查看文档了解更多信息,加入我们的 Discord 社区,与社区成员交流心得,共同探索undb
的无限可能。
让我们一起探索这个创新的数据管理新世界,让数据管理工作变得更加简单和愉快!
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考